The mandate of the President of the Republic lasts for five years, and begins with the swearing in of the National Assembly.
The President of the Republic expresses the state unity of the Republic of Serbia and represents the Republic of Serbia in the country and abroad.
The President of the Republic proposes to the National Assembly a candidate for Prime Minister whenever a new Government is elected and is obliged to propose the candidate who can secure the election of the Government.
The President of the Republic may return the voted law to the National Assembly for reconsideration if he considers that the law is not in accordance with the Constitution or that it is in conflict with confirmed international treaties or generally accepted rules of international law, or that the procedure prescribed for the adoption of the law was not followed during the adoption of the law, or that the law does not regulate an area in an appropriate manner.
The President of the Republic may, in accordance with the Constitution and the law, dissolve the National Assembly at the reasoned proposal of the Government and, in doing so, makes a decision calling for elections for deputies.
The President of the Republic promulgates the law by decree, dissolves the National Assembly, appoints and recalls ambassadors of the Republic of Serbia, awards decorations and appoints, promotes and dismisses officers of the Serbian Armed Forces.
By decision, the President of the Republic announces elections for deputies, proposes to the National Assembly candidates for Prime Minister, grants pardons, appoints the General Secretary of the President of the Republic, the Chief of Cabinet of the President of the Republic, advisers to the President of the Republic and other officials in the General Secretariat of the President of the Republic.
The President of the Republic commands the Army and appoints, promotes and dismisses officers of the Serbian Army.
